The PFAS contains an anchorage, adapters, body harness and might consist of a lanyard, deceleration device, lifeline or ideal mix of these. Past these necessary components of the PFAS, there are additionally details autumn distances linked with the performance of the arrest system. Especially, there is a complete loss distance that the PFAS must enable to aid the employee in preventing call with the ground or other surface area below.
Along with the loss range requirements for every element of the PFAS, the anchorage of the PFAS must additionally have the ability to sustain a minimum 5,000 pounds per employee. OSHA policies have numerous demands. The cost-free autumn range, to the range that the worker goes down before the PFAS begins to work and reduces the speed of the autumn, must be 6 feet More about the author or less, nor call any reduced degree.
The D-ring shift, the distance that the harness stretches and just how much the D-ring itself moves when it experiences the complete weight of the worker during an autumn, is normally presumed to be 1 Continued foot, depending upon the devices layout and the manufacturer of the harness. For the back D-ring elevation, the distance in between the D-ring and the sole of the employee's shoes, companies frequently utilize 5 feet as the typical elevation with the assumption that the employee will certainly be 6 feet in elevation, yet due to the fact that the D-ring height irregularity can affect the security of the system, the back D-ring height has to be calculated based on the actual height of the employee.

Autumn restraint systems are not explicitly defined or discussed in OSHA's autumn protection standards for building and construction, they are allowed by OSHA as specified in an OSHA letter of analysis last upgraded in 2004. Roofing Services Sydney. OSHA does not have any kind of certain demands for autumn restraint systems, but advises that any loss restriction system be qualified of standing up to 3,000 extra pounds or at the very least two times the maximum forecasted force necessary to conserve the worker from falling to the reduced surface area
Warning lines are passive systems that permit a boundary to be formed around the functioning location to make sure that employees recognize dangerous edges. Caution lines are just permitted on roofings with a low incline (having an incline of less than or equivalent to 4 inches of upright increase for every 12 inches straight length (4:12)).
Safety surveillance systems use safety and security monitors to keep track of the security of other workers on the roofing. The security display is charged to make certain the safety of various other employees on the roof and need to be able to by mouth warn a staff member when they are in a hazardous scenario.
